Puddle Or Ice Cube
In which form do we meet the world?
What are we more like: an ice cube or a puddle?
- Ice cube: Firm, rigid. When ice cubes collide, they bounce off each other. No real connection, no value shared.
- Puddle: Soft, adaptable. When puddles meet, they can merge, share what they hold, and reform easily. There's connection, resilience, and exchange.
Which state allows for more growth, learning, and meaningful connection?
Something worth pondering today.
